When Maddy first wakes up to find a tiny, living, breathing cat on her pillow, she can't believe her luck. Greykin tells her that he and the other ceramic cats have bonded with her and will now come to life whenever she needs help helping others. 
In Paw Power, Maddy and Greykin have a tricky problem to solve: there's a new girl in school who's being picked on by the class bully. Will a little bit of magic and a lot of courage be enough to stop the scariest girl in the school? This first book in the exciting new Pocket Cats series is sure to delight young independent readers.

      Gr 2-4-Nine-year-old Maddy Lloyd wants a kitten more than anything, but her younger brother is allergic. With the pet she can't have still on her mind, she finds three ceramic cats at an antique market and impulsively trades her lucky coin for the set. That night, the largest one, Greykin, comes to life. His mission is to help Maddy solve a bullying problem at school. With small sketches on most spreads and a simple story line with few side plots, this book is a good choice for reluctant readers. Maddy is a believable character who faces her fears with the help of one magic feline. Purchase where Sue Bentley's "Magic Kitten" series (Grosset & Dunlap) is popular.-Kelly Roth, Bartow County Public Library, Cartersville, GA

      Maddy settles for three ceramic cats instead of the real thing and is soon surprised when one of them--Greykin--comes to life. The magic cat's mission is to help Maddy confront the school bully and discover her own inner strength. Though the text is cutesy, the book, with its large type and numerous illustrations, will appeal to newly independent, cat-loving readers.
